How to decode a 1997 Buick Century VIN

Characters 1-3 of a 1997 Buick Century VIN

World Manufacturer Identifier (WMI) codes are unique sequences used to identify the manufacturer of every vehicle globally. Each WMI code contains three elements: the first character identifies the country of manufacture, the second character identifies the manufacturer, and the third character, along with the first two, tells us about the vehicle type and manufacturing division. For instance, the 1997 Buick Century uses the WMI “2G4”, indicating it was manufactured in the United States (“2”) by General Motors LLC (“G”) and is classified as a passenger car (“4”). This coding is essential for tracking, regulation, and identification purposes, providing detailed information about the vehicle’s origin and category. Such a code is integral for automotive manufacturers, and authorities ensure every vehicle can be uniquely identified.

Characters 4-8 are the Vehicle Descriptor Section (VDS) of a 1997 Buick Century VIN

These characters correspond to components like:

  • Engine type
  • Transmission
  • Model or trim
  • Body style
  • Gross vehicle weight range

Auto manufacturers have some discretion to decide how they want to code this section, but its contents and decoded results are generally consistent.

Character 9 is the “check digit” in a 1997 Buick Century VIN.

Based on a formula developed by the US Department of Transportation, it helps reduce fraud by ensuring the validity of the VIN.

VIN Characters 12 - 17 of a 1997 Buick Century

The final 6 characters in a 1997 Buick Century’s 17-digit VIN are its serial number, which will be unique to every vehicle.

How to find a 1997 Buick Century’s VIN?

Locating the VIN number on your 1997 Buick Century is key for identification. Here’s how to find it:

  1. Check the dashboard on the driver’s side of your Buick Century. The VIN is likely visible through the windshield on a small plate near where the dashboard meets the glass.
  2. Look at the door frame of the driver’s side door on your 1997 Buick Century. There’s usually a VIN plate or sticker on the door pillar when you open the door.
  3. Examine the engine block of your Buick Century; the VIN can sometimes be found stamped onto the engine itself.
  4. Inspect the trunk area, sometimes there’s a VIN plate or sticker located in the spare tire wheel well or on the trunk lid of the 1997 Buick Century.
  5. Check the vehicle’s title, registration, or insurance paperwork, as the VIN for your Buick Century will be listed on all official documents related to the car.
